Openerp:在表单视图中显示多个字段

时间:2012-06-25 09:56:12

标签: python xml openerp

有一个字段很多。当我试图打开该字段的树视图时,它显示为空!

这是我的领域:

 'classb_id': fields.many2one('class.a', 'Reception', required=True, select=True),

在我的表单视图中:

 <field name="classb_id"/>

我已经为class.a创建了一些记录,但是树视图没有显示任何数据

4 个答案:

答案 0 :(得分:1)

您好通过在关系表class.a中创建关系和创建记录来完成70%的工作,但现在在您创建关系字段的地方classb_id打开表单视图和该字段classb_id从模型class.a中选择一些记录并保存它,然后您就可以看到关系记录值。在这里你做了什么id你创建了所有设置,但最后一步是错误的,即选择你的关系领域的字段关系记录。

答案 1 :(得分:0)

As there is a relation with class "class.a" , 
there must be data for that object.
then and then it will show you datas in the tree view of that m2o filed.

注意:您可以使用视图中的新按钮

为类“class.a”创建新记录

答案 2 :(得分:0)

检查您是否添加了两个或更多“classb_id”字段。在openerp v6.0中,当您添加两次相同的字段时,只有一个字段会在模型中显示数据,而其他字段将显示为空。

如果这不能解决您的问题,请显示模型class.a,其名称字段,如果没有添加名称字段,则显示其_rec_name字段等

答案 3 :(得分:0)

在class.a对象中

你有&#34;活跃&#34;领域。

如果是,则默认为True。否则它不会显示在列表视图中。